Easy Mini Greek Meat Loaves with Tzatziki Sauce


Ingredients:

Meat Loaves:

1 lb extra-lean (at least 90%) ground beef
1/2 box (9-oz size) frozen spinach, cooked, well drained (about 1/2 cup)
1 small onion, finely chopped (1/4 cup)
1/3 cup old-fashioned or quick-cooking oats
2 oz crumbled feta cheese
1 egg plus 1 egg white
1 teaspoon dried oregano leaves, crushed
1/2 teaspoon garlic sal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per

Tzatziki Sauce:

3/4 cup plain yogurt
1/2 medium cucumber, peeled, seeded and finely chopped (1/2 cup)
1 tablespoon olive oil
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 clove garlic, finely chopped

Directions:


Heat oven to 350°F. Spray 8 regular-size muffin cups with cooking spray.

In medium bowl, mix meat loaves ingredients. Scoop generous 1/3 cup meat mixture into each muffin cup, pressing down slightly.

Bake 30 to 35 minutes or until meat thermometer inserted in center of one loaf reads 160ºF. Let stand in pan 5 minutes.

Meanwhile, in small bowl, mix tzatziki sauce ingredients; refrigerate until serving time. Serve meat loaves with tzatziki sauce.
